The Bearcats did a nice job on national TV last night.

Zach Collaros is a very solid QB.

It was a good night for the Big East.

It could be an even better Saturday if WVU is somehow able to defeat LSU.

The fact is that the remaining members of the BE have decent talent with WVU, So. Florida, Cincinnati, Louisville, and Rutgers and UConn.

With the automatic BCS berth in hand, I can't believe that those schools cannot secure two more solid programs, a decent TV contract and a firm future commitement from the BCS.

If SU had not been approached by the ACC, I would want Dr. Gross to work toward a permanent solution to the BE situation.
